Npm inline source map download

Choose a style of source mapping to enhance the debugging process. Create an inline source map comment from a source map object or string shinnn inlinesourcemap comment. Download my free books, and check out my upcoming fullstack javascript bootcamp. Commonjs bundler with aliasing, extensibility, and source maps from the minified js bundle. Uglifyjs can generate a source map file, which is highly useful for debugging your compressed javascript. Webpackdevserver doesnt generate source maps stack. The arguments will only be passed to the script specified after npm run and not to any pre or post script the env script is a special builtin command that can be used to list environment variables that will be available to the script at runtime. Net core application template which will run debugging from visual studio. A webpack plugin to inline source in html, wrapper of inlinesource. The inline ones are valuable during development due to better performance while the separate ones are handy for production use as it keeps the bundle size small.

There is a shellexecutable utility script, babelexternalhelpers. Edit the markdown source for usinglessinthebrowser using less. The output mimics nodes stack trace format with the goal of making every compiletojs language. An instance of the sourcemapgenerator represents a source map which is being built incrementally. I think inline sourcemaps inlinesourcemap would be a good. This loader is especially useful when using 3rdparty. Mar 04, 2017 the webpackdevserver then bundles the modules and launches a static web server inline for live reloading. Use the sourcemapdevtoolplugin for a more fine grained configuration. The webpackdevserver then bundles the modules and launches a static web server inline for live reloading. Debuggable javascript in production with source maps. I then noticed the source maps where now in the js files, and i could then find the typescript files under webpack. Embed javascript and css source inline when using the webpack dev server or middleware 1. Source map keeps the transformed code and the original code in sync so that when debugging, the developer has the option to look into the original code instead of the complex bundled code. If both commands work, your installation was a success, and you can start using node.

Compiling assets mix laravel the php framework for web. Then webpack bundles the modules according to the nfig below optimized with a source map for production. A sourcemapconsumer instance represents a parsed source map which we can query for information about the original file positions by giving it a file position in the generated source itializeoptions when using sourcemapconsumer outside of node. For a complete breakdown, read the release changelog and the v3. Use webpackdevserver dd is shorthand for debug devtool sourcemap outputpathinfo outputpathinfo adds comments to the generated bundle that explain what modulefiles are included in what places. Which version of the source map spec this map is following. Its main purpose is to bundle javascript files for usage in a browser, yet it is also capable of transforming, bundling, or packaging just about any resource or asset. Babel comes with a builtin cli which can be used to compile files from the command line. This plugin enables more fine grained control of source map generation. Get browser versions of the node core libraries events, stream, path, url, assert, buffer, util, querystring, vm, and crypto when you require them. Setting up a react project using webpack and babel dev. Inline source maps are embedded in the source file. These values can affect build and rebuild speed dramatically. A preprocessor with source maps support to help use typescript with jest.

Webpackdevserver doesnt generate source maps stack overflow. This includes both inline source maps as well as those linked via url. Adds source mappings and base64 encodes them, so they can be inlined in your generated file. Create an inline source map comment from a source map object or string shinnninlinesourcemapcomment. To get a source map, pass source map output output. Up until this point, all of our examples assume that your source maps are publicly available, and. Actually, i did get it working by following the above, but i needed to add the inline source map into the else block, ie line 28 in browser. The env script is a special builtin command that can be used to list environment variables that will be available to the script at runtime. It uses the sourcemap module to replace the paths and line numbers of sourcemapped files with their original paths and line numbers. In some situations you might want to include inline sourcemaps into evaluated code. Then webpack bundles the modules according to the nfig below. If your js file has an inline source map, then its last line will look something like this. Download the latest releasesource code, compiled assets, and documentationas a zip file directly from github. There is a stackoverflow question about source maps in evaluated code.

This option controls if and how source maps are generated. See the sourcemaploader to deal with existing source maps devtool. The output mimics nodes stack trace format with the goal of making every compiletojs language more of a firstclass citizen. Dependencies 3 dependent packages 141 dependent repositories 325 total releases. The npm start command is using the crossenv plugin to set the node environment variable properly for the platform.

Top 1,000 packages with largest number of dependencies. If an env command is defined in your package, it will take precedence over the builtin. To support files with inline source maps, the hookrequire options can be specified, which will. See the source map loader to deal with existing source maps devtool.

Generates mappings for the given source and adds them, assuming that no translation from original to generated is necessary. How to generate less source maps without npm stack overflow. Using npm, webpack, and typescript to create simple asp. Actually, i did get it working by following the above, but i needed to add the inlinesourcemap into the else block, ie line 28 in browser. So in the generated code, the comment is added to this line of code.

The npm run build command uses crossenv to set the environment flag. Or you can even include the entire source map inline not recommended. This makes it trivial to piece together different effects and techniques from the community. This gist is updated daily via cron job and lists stats for npm packages. Get browser versions of the node core libraries events, stream, path, url, assert, buffer, util, querystring, vm. Go to the ckeditor 5 builds download page and download your preferred build. The arguments will only be passed to the script specified after npm run and not to any pre or post script. Target provides a default in case webpack is ran without npm module. Converts source map to an inline comment that can be appended to. All source map data is passed to webpack for processing as per a chosen source map style specified by the devtool option in nfig. To publish and install packages to and from the public npm registry or your companys npm enterprise registry, you must install node. Hit the project repository or sass repository for more options.

Compiling assets mix laravel the php framework for. The filename of the generated source that this source map is associated with. The only parameter is the raw source map either as a string which can be json. Check out tools like beefy or runbrowser which make automating browserify development easier. It uses the source map module to replace the paths and line numbers of source mapped files with their original paths and line numbers. Jul 25, 2016 for a complete breakdown, read the release changelog and the v3. This module provides source map support for stack traces in node via the v8 stack trace api. Ionic 4 no typescript source maps for android issue. It is recommended to include the editor version in the directory name to ensure proper cache. Resolve the source map andor sources for a generated file.

Webpack will assemble your files, generate a source map, and reference that source map in the built javascript file via the sourcemappingurl directive. Webpack, react jsx, babel, es6, simple config ensure that you install the correct npm dependencies babel decided to split itself into a bunch of. Parcel has out of the box support for js, css, html, file assets, and more no plugins needed. I write this tutorial primarily to demonstrate how to quickly create a simple application with support for npm, webpack, and typescript based on an initial asp. By default, laravel homestead includes everything you need.

768 1596 735 957 496 98 596 227 50 1281 318 1353 847 562 1085 217 620 494 1261 725 593 1455 1063 47 562 745 361 757 1482 1065 18 1327 526 69 1296 1327 1554 739 590 649 341 544 533 531 843 576 1052 382 597 1227